2. Mechanics Built for Speed

Unlike auto-crash games that run continuously, Chicken Road grants you control at every step. You set your bet, choose the difficulty—ranging from Easy’s 24 steps to Hardcore’s 15—and then watch the chicken advance one block at a time.

The multiplier climbs with each successful step, but the risk magnifies as you progress. A single misstep into a hidden trap ends the round instantly, wiping out any accumulated multiplier.

This turn‑by‑turn pacing forces players to make split‑second choices about whether to continue or cash out—making each round feel like a high‑stakes sprint.
